Can you explain the choice of shardanet and impaler? My thought is that this is the perfect choice for the elites but as it only affects what is in base contact with it, I would rather have the razorflails or hydra gauntlets in regular wych units. Whilst I am equally bemused as you are as to why the Hellions are in the list the shardnet and impaler have a clear role here. For attacking the razorflail is the only choice as it out performs the hydra Gauntlets on 5 out of 6 Combat drug results. However the purpose here of the Wyches is not killing but speed bumping and tarpitting. Hence the shardnets make perfect sense as they increase the survivability of the unit.

I have used the Barron and hellions combo in the 4 games I have played. They have excelled in every game I have played in. They are fantastic when played right. They hit hard, shooting first and then with the Barron and a agonizer in the unit will ruin many units day. Don't underestimate their hit and run ability. Not a fan of the stun claw. Perhaps in a 5 man unit but then whats the point. Big thumbs up!
I also like warrior squads in raiders with shadow shields and flicker fields and splinter racks. STUPID expensive but its nice watching a unit trying to rapid fire you and finding themselves out of range, while you return the favor. Killed a 8 man squad of Plague marines that way. Will probably ditch the upgrades after I buy more models. Using the extra points to boost myself to higher point values. I am however glad I got to try them. Very useful upgrades. Play a bit and try them out. You might end up keeping some of them. Use only if you need them.
Wytchs as stated before are not killy units but speed bumps. I run my one squad with my archon and it works great! Killy... but not overly killy. DE do not want to wipe units out in one turn of combat very often, as stated before. It really bears repeating. Your small but beefed up units of incubi could run into the problem of killing too quickly and facing return fire. I would keep them free of characters and remove all options. That has been my thought process with them anyway.
